5. Objectives or Learning Outcomes
Course learning outcomes
Description
To acquire basic knowledge of beer production processes.
To acquire the necessary knowledge to make aromatised wines.
To learn about the production process and the features of the main wine distillates.
To know the elaboration process and the main features of some important distillates that have other raw materials than grapes.
Additional outcomes
Not established.
6. Units / Contents
  • Unit 1: Wine distillates
  • Unit 2: Rectified alcohols, distillates and spirits
  • Unit 3: Aromatised wines: vermouths and wine appetizers
  • Unit 4: Other wine-based beverages
  • Unit 5: Whisky
  • Unit 6: Rum
  • Unit 7: Brandy
  • Unit 8: Tequila
  • Unit 9: Vodka and Gin
  • Unit 10: Spirits
  • Unit 11: Beer
  • Unit 12: Cider
  • Unit 13: Sake

8. Evaluation criteria and Grading System
Evaluation System Continuous assessment Non-continuous evaluation * Description
Practicum and practical activities reports assessment 15.00% 15.00% The practical knowledge acquired in the laboratory will be assessed through the completion of a practical report and proposed questionnaires.
Oral presentations assessment 15.00% 15.00% The development of a topic proposed by the teacher will be carried out and must be presented orally.
Final test 70.00% 70.00% Assessment test consisting of evaluating the knowledge acquired by the student during the course.
Total: 100.00% 100.00%  
According to art. 4 of the UCLM Student Evaluation Regulations, it must be provided to students who cannot regularly attend face-to-face training activities the passing of the subject, having the right (art. 12.2) to be globally graded, in 2 annual calls per subject , an ordinary and an extraordinary one (evaluating 100% of the competences).

Evaluation criteria for the final exam:
  • Continuous assessment:
    For continuous assessment, the completion and/or delivery of all assessable training activities will be proposed within a reasonable period of time and sufficiently separated from each other, which will be set by the teacher. The minimum mark required for each of the compulsory and assessable training activities must reach a minimum of 40% of the grade for that activity. In order to pass the subject, a minimum mark of 50% of the overall mark will be required, after applying the percentages corresponding to each of the assessable training activities.
  • Non-continuous evaluation:
    Any student with difficulties in following the proposed development of the subject may change to the non-continuous assessment modality provided that he/she has not participated during the period of classes in assessable activities that together account for at least 50% of the total assessment of the subject. In this case, it will be an essential requirement to submit the presentation of a topic proposed by the lecturer as well as the practical report prior to the final exam. The minimum mark required for each of the evaluable training activities will be 40% of the grade for that activity.
